Einzelnen Beitrag anzeigen

Der_Unwissende

Registriert seit: 13. Dez 2003
Ort: Berlin
1.756 Beiträge
 
#7

Re: Fließkommazahlen Delphi vs. Oracle

  Alt 4. Jun 2007, 11:04
Zitat von Raffigator:
In der Txt-Datei sind die Fließkommazahlen mit einem ',' gespeichert.
Ich lese also die Zahl mit dem Komma als String ein und will es dann in der fConvertStrToDouble umwandeln. Wie du siehst habe ich da auch schonmal mit den TFormatSettings gearbeitet. (Ist das überhaupt .Net-Kompatibel?)
Wie gesagt, bisher sind bei mir alle Versuche mit dem Komma als Separator zu arbeiten, fehlgeschlagen.
Ok, nochmal, Du liest Die Daten aus einer txt-Datei? Wenn diese dort mit einem Komma als Seperator stehen, solltest Du auf jeden Fall die Umwandlung immer mit einem Komma als Dezimalseperator vornehmen. Ich dachte eigentlich, dass Du die Werte eben als Strings in eine SQL-Anfrage steckst und Oracle dann damit seine Probleme hat. Die Übergabe von umgewandelten Zahlen sollte hingegen kein Problem sein, da sich hier die Anbindung der DB um die korrekte Umwandlung kümmern müsste. Wenn Du allerdings dort Deinen Fehler hast (hab ich dann nur falsch verstanden), dann fällt mir auch nichts ein.
  Mit Zitat antworten Zitat